Research in the past decade on immunogenic cell death (ICD) has shown that immunogenicity of dying tumor cells is crucial for effective anticancer therapy. ICD induction leads to emission specific damage-associated molecular patterns (DAMPs), which act as danger signals and adjuvants activate anti-tumor immune responses, leading elimination formation long-term immunological memory. can be triggered by many treatment modalities, including photodynamic therapy (PDT). New water-soluble polynorbornenes P1–P4 containing oligoether, amino acid groups and luminophoric complexes of iridium(III) were synthesized by ring-opening metathesis polymerization.
